## UPSC CSE Context **Why in News:** Foundation laid for Adani Group's ₹2,500 crore missile and propellant plant in Shivpuri, Madhya Pradesh. **Syllabus Connection:** Security: Defence production and indigenization; Government policies and interventions for industrial development. **Exam Relevance:** Relevant for questions on defence indigenization, private sector participation in defence manufacturing, and regional development. ## Core Issue A missile and propellant manufacturing facility is being set up by the Adani Defence and Aerospace at a cost of... **Key Development:** Foundation laid for a ₹2,500 crore defence manufacturing facility by Adani Defence and Aerospace in Shivpuri, MP. **Stakeholders:** - Madhya Pradesh Government - Union Ministry of Defence - Local MSMEs - Local population ## Static Knowledge **High-Value Background:** - India's defence production policy encourages private sector participation under 'Make in India' and 'Atmanirbhar Bharat'. - Shivpuri is in the Chambal region, historically known for dacoity, now being developed for industrial growth. **Concepts in Context:** - Missile and propellant manufacturing involves sensitive technology and requires strict quality and security protocols. - MSME integration into defence supply chain is a key policy goal to boost local manufacturing. **Institutions and Mechanisms:** - Defence Acquisition Procedure (DAP) 2020 promotes indigenous manufacturing. - Industrial Corridor development in MP under National Industrial Corridor Programme. ## Dynamic Analysis ### Security - Enhances India's self-reliance in missile and propellant production, reducing import dependency. - Strategic location in central India may offer security advantages over coastal plants. - Private sector entry in defence manufacturing can increase competition and innovation. - Requires robust oversight to ensure quality and prevent technology leakage. ### Economy - ₹2,500 crore investment and 4,000-5,000 jobs boost local economy in backward region. - Potential to attract further defence and aerospace investments in MP. - Risk of cost overruns and delays common in large defence projects. ### Governance - Demonstrates state government's investor-friendly policies and ease of doing business. - Aligns with central government's 'Atmanirbhar Bharat' and 'Make in India' initiatives. - Need for transparent land acquisition and environmental clearances. - Ensuring local employment and skill development for sustainable impact. ## Prelims Takeaways - Adani Defence and Aerospace is a subsidiary of Adani Group. - Shivpuri district is in Madhya Pradesh, part of the Chambal region. ## Mains Value Addition **Arguments:** - Defence industrial corridors can spur regional development and create employment. **Examples:** - Adani Group's defence plant in Shivpuri, MP, is a model for private sector-led defence manufacturing. **Data Points:** - ₹2,500 crore investment in missile and propellant plant. - Employment generation for 4,000-5,000 people. **Counterpoints:** - Private sector involvement may lead to profit-driven compromises on quality and security. - Dependence on a single private player could create monopolistic tendencies. ## Way Forward - Establish robust quality assurance and security protocols for private defence manufacturing. - Promote MSME clusters around defence plants to maximize local economic impact. - Develop skill development programs in collaboration with local institutions to meet industry needs. - Monitor project timelines and costs to prevent delays and overruns.
